The Rise of QR Codes in Restaurants
QR codes are becoming increasingly common in restaurants. The epidemic may have accelerated the use of QR codes in eateries, but their utility has long outlasted the crisis. QR codes, which were initially utilized as a contactless method of accessing menus, have proven to be a cost-effective and adaptable technology that improves both consumer satisfaction and operational efficiency.

3. Immersive Digital Content
QR codes may turn static eating experiences into interactive journeys.
- AR Integration: Scanning a code can bring recipes to life using augmented reality graphics that illustrate ingredients or cooking processes.
- Video Storytelling: QR codes can direct guests to films of the chef cooking their meal, establishing a link between the food and its creators.
- Cultural Insights: QR codes can be used by restaurants serving foreign cuisines to communicate the cultural value or history of their meals.
Impact: These immersive experiences make eating memorable and shareable, prompting guests to spread the word on social media.

7. Transparency during dining
Modern eaters want to learn more about their cuisine. QR codes may provide:
- Ingredient supply information, nutritional data, and allergen information.
- Stories about local farmers or suppliers demonstrate the restaurant’s commitment to quality and sustainability.
Why It is Important: Transparency fosters trust and improves the restaurant’s reputation.
